Investing calculators: frequently asked questions

How does compound interest grow my money?

You earn returns not just on your original money but on the returns it has already earned, so growth accelerates over time. The longer the horizon and the more often it compounds, the larger the effect. The compound interest calculator plots this curve for your figures.

What is dollar-cost averaging?

It means investing a fixed amount on a regular schedule regardless of price, so you buy more units when prices are low and fewer when high. It removes the pressure of timing the market and smooths your average cost, which the DCA calculator illustrates.

What return rate should I assume?

Long-run stock market averages have historically been around 7% to 10% before inflation, but returns vary widely year to year and the past does not guarantee the future. Run a conservative and an optimistic scenario rather than relying on a single number.
